If it is no longer possible to regrind your tool, it will be returned to you unmachined. The published prices apply irrespective of the condition your tool arrives in. Of course, the prices of our regrinding service are also calculated fairly and transparently – with CERATIZIT's ReStart programme there are no additional charges for cutting off, roughing geometries, etc. The process also extends the tool's life span at the same time, so new purchases make up a substantially lower proportion of your budget. Our professional regrinding service restores tools to almost their original performance capacity through the use of original geometries and coatings, so they can continue to meet all quality parameters to the highest possible standard. This begs the question: buy new or have the drill reground? After all, regrinding can usually be carried out multiple times with no issue using the CERATIZIT ReStart regrinding service for cutting tools. Call us at (407) 385-3511.At some point, even the sturdy HSS drill has reached its wear limit. If you have any questions about our stock of solid carbide drill bits, contact us! We’ll be happy to answer your questions and help you find what you need. Carbide tipped drill bits are a cheaper alternative that will do a good job for most projects and will get the job done to a high standard in most cases. They also create sharper and finer edges than many other drill bits. They are best used in industrial manufacturing and are generally not needed for DIY projects.Ĭarbide drill bits are expensive by comparison but will be more effective on certain materials and will withstand more use without wearing. Solid Carbide Drill Bits OverviewĬarbide drill bits can withstand high temperatures, more than cobalt or HSS. Hardened steel drill bits are not quite as long-lasting as carbide drill bits that can save money and time in the long-run. Due to their hardness, solid tungsten carbide drill bits last a lot longer than most other drill bits. Machine shops are used to sharpen these and extend their life. However, any drill bit is going to gradually wear and carbide drill bits are no different. These are particularly useful in mining, construction, and farming due to their longevity. Some drill bits are coated with tungsten carbide rather than being formed entirely from the material. Solid carbide drill bits for hardened steel aren’t always made entirely of tungsten carbide. The Benefits to Carbide Drill BitsĪs previously mentioned, carbide can be recycled which saves money and makes it more environmentally friendly. Carbide recyclers use scrap carbide to create new carbide drill bits.Ĭarbide drill bits are used to drill into the hardest materials, including masonry, but because of brittleness, they are only used in automated production. This premium material comes at a cost but is extremely durable and keeps its sharp edge for longer than most other drill bits.Īs carbide drill bits are not cheap to produce, they are frequently recycled to cut costs. Solid carbide drill bits are often made from tough tungsten, which makes them perfect for drilling. They are used to create holes in conjunction with a drill. What are Solid Carbide Drills Bits?Ĭarbide drill bits are available in many shapes and sizes and have a variety of applications in the manufacturing industry. If additives are not used, the carbide tool will chemically react with ferrous materials and create a crater in the tool. These drill bits are made from grains of tungsten carbide, other material particles, and metal cobalt. As a result, it’s a popular choice for tough jobs.Īnother type of carbide drill bit is known as cemented carbide. This material provides faster cutting speed, more durability, and longevity. Buy Solid Carbide Drill Bits from Drill Bits USAĬarbide drill bits are made from tungsten carbide, a compound of carbon and tungsten.
0 Comments
Var_dump() is a powerful native PHP function that will output detailed information about any type of data contained in a PHP program, including arrays. Print More Detailed Array Data with var_dump() Here is a demonstration of how to use print_r(): The native PHP print_r() function will show the entire array including index numbers and values without needing to loop through it. $items = foreach ( $items as $key => $value ) Key is: 0 value is: apple The easiest way to show data from an array in PHP is to loop through it using a foreach statement and echo each item individually. Print Data in PHP Array with foreach loop I tried to echo each of them but I get 'Array' instead of the values which are saved inside of each Arrays. In PHP, objects can be converted into JSON String using the PHP function json_encode().Ī common use of JSON is to read data from a web server and display the data on a web page.Įxample the above example, we assign the value to the object variable, and then, in json_encode(), we convert the matter to the array variable and make the associative array.In this tutorial, we will learn some different ways of printing/echoing an array in PHP. Echo Arrays in Array Ask Question Asked 9 years, 3 months ago Modified 9 years, 3 months ago Viewed 5k times 0 I have an Array with mutltiple Arrays in it. There are basically three types of arrays in PHP: Indexed or Numeric Arrays: An array with a numeric index where values are stored linearly. After this, we used the print_r() function, which prints all the array elements and their indexes. An array is created using an array() function in PHP. Then, explode() function breaks this string into an array. 14 Answers Sorted by: 588 To see the contents of array you can use: printr (array) or if you want nicely formatted array then: echo '' printr (array) echo '' Use vardump (array) to get more information of the content in the array like the datatype and length. In the above example, a string variable is assigned some value. Start by defining the foreach loop and then use the echo statement inside it to. You can use a foreach construct to loop through the array. To output the values of an associative array you need to loop through the array and echo out each value individually. It prints all the values of the array along with their index number. Using the PHP echo statement to output arrays is a simple and straightforward task. The first is for the separator, the second for array_name, and the last for the limit. Use printr () Function to Echo or Print an Array in PHP The built-in function printr () is used to print the value stored in a variable in PHP. explode() functionīy using explode() function, we can convert a string into an array of elements. For that, we can use PHP's explode() function. You can also convert that string into an array if required. The first is the separator, and the other one is the array_name. Two parameters are passed in the implode() function. The implode() function will convert the array into a string in the following line. arrayofarrays a, Not that lucky, 2, smoke detectors, d, boring street in, U.S., nothing happens. In the above example, an array variable is declared and assigned some values at the first line. The separator parameter in implode() function is optional. There are two ways to convert an array into a string in PHP.īy using the implode() function, we can convert all array elements into a string. This code explains how to convert an array to a string in PHP using implode function. We often need to convert a PHP array to a string. If you do not have the requisite authority, you may not accept the License Agreement or use the SDK on behalf of your employer or other entity.ģ.1 Subject to the terms of the License Agreement, Google grants you a limited, worldwide, royalty-free, non-assignable, non-exclusive, and non-sublicensable license to use the SDK solely to develop applications for compatible implementations of Android.ģ.2 You may not use this SDK to develop applications for other platforms (including non-compatible implementations of Android) or to develop another SDK. You may not use the SDK if you do not accept the License Agreement.Ģ.2 By clicking to accept and/or using this SDK, you hereby agree to the terms of the License Agreement.Ģ.3 You may not use the SDK and may not accept the License Agreement if you are a person barred from receiving the SDK under the laws of the United States or other countries, including the country in which you are resident or from which you use the SDK.Ģ.4 If you are agreeing to be bound by the License Agreement on behalf of your employer or other entity, you represent and warrant that you have full legal authority to bind your employer or such entity to the License Agreement. The License Agreement forms a legally binding contract between you and Google in relation to your use of the SDK.ġ.2 "Android" means the Android software stack for devices, as made available under the Android Open Source Project, which is located at the following URL:, as updated from time to time.ġ.3 A "compatible implementation" means any Android device that (i) complies with the Android Compatibility Definition document, which can be found at the Android compatibility website () and which may be updated from time to time and (ii) successfully passes the Android Compatibility Test Suite (CTS).ġ.4 "Google" means Google LLC, organized under the laws of the State of Delaware, USA, and operating under the laws of the USA with principal place of business at 1600 Amphitheatre Parkway, Mountain View, CA 94043, USA.Ģ.1 In order to use the SDK, you must first agree to the License Agreement. This is the Android Software Development Kit License Agreementġ.1 The Android Software Development Kit (referred to in the License Agreement as the "SDK" and specifically including the Android system files, packaged APIs, and Google APIs add-ons) is licensed to you subject to the terms of the License Agreement. The Cubase audio engine delivers ultimate, no-compromise quality.Enhanced tools for video soundtrack production.Many improvements and a new user interface enhance the best drum production tool.Channel strip overhaul offers better metering and functionality.Ultimate control of your audio, with more creative tools and Smart Controls to speed up workflow.Overview of Steinberg Cubase Pro Features Cubase 10 makes music production more inspiring, intuitive, and flexible. There is also a new, modern user interface and enhanced audio quality. It includes many new tools to enhance creativity and speed up workflow. Whether you record an orchestra, a huge live rock show, or a band in the studio, Cubase Pro is sublime in every sense of the word.Ĭubase delivers many impressive new features in a compelling software package. Cubase Pro combines outstanding audio quality, intuitive handling, and highly advanced audio and MIDI tools that star producers and musicians use for composing, recording, mixing, and editing music. Overview of Steinberg Cubase Pro BenefitsĬubase Pro condenses almost three decades of Steinberg development into the most cutting-edge DAW anywhere. Whether you’re a professional composer or a music production beginner, Cubase provides you with everything you need to turn your ideas into music. It comprises various virtual instruments, effects, and thousands of sounds. With its unrivaled range of flexible tools, you can create any music quickly and intuitively. It is one of the most influential music creation software packages globally. Free Download Steinberg Cubase Pro for Windows. In 2017, for example, a landslide destroyed part of the city and caused more than 300 deaths. Its geographic position puts it at high risk of natural disasters. Map of Colombian city of Mocoa and Mocoa River in Putumayo department / source: GoogleĪll this is why a Canadian mining company appearing to move forward on exploring mining possibilities in Putumayo has raised questions about a progressive government that won power by promising environmental protection. Any alteration of the natural state of this area is likely to impact the entire Amazon rainforest, often referred to as the “lungs” of the Earth, for absorbing carbon dioxide and releasing life-giving oxygen into the atmosphere. It is here where the Caquetá and Putumayo rivers originate, both major tributaries of the Amazon River. In this richly biodiverse region, where the cool mountains of the Andes meet the steamy Amazon rainforest, opinions are divided and emotions fume over the environmental and social costs of housing a “green” mining project. The biodiverse Putumayo department is home to more than 150 animal species, which is why environmentalist groups worry about mining activities / credit: Antonio Cascio An Andean Saddle-Back Tamarin monkey ( Leontocebus fuscicollis) in the Mocoa area. “And today,” de la Cruz told Toward Freedom, “in the 21st century, they tell us they are taking the copper from Mother Earth.” The priest remarked on contemporary plans to explore and mine for copper and molybdenum to feed “clean energy” technologies in what could be one of the largest deposits of these minerals on the continent and in the world. “Over three centuries, the umbilical cord of Mother Earth has been cut.”ĭe la Cruz, who opposes the extraction of minerals in Colombia’s Putumayo Department, referred to thousands of rubber trees that had been cut down, along with 70,000 Indigenous people who died in the western Amazon during the extraction of rubber, timber, oil and quinine (a substance used to prevent malaria). MOCOA, Colombia-“We are experiencing a profound crisis, not only in the Amazon, but throughout ,” said Campo Elías de la Cruz, a Catholic priest and environmental activist. Water is worth more than copper.” The march initiated a four-day event called the Festival in Defense of the Mountain, Water and Life, held to protest the company’s copper mining project / credit: Antonio Cascio The banner reads, “Mocoa says no to megamineria. A demonstration in March 2022 against Canada-based mining company Libero Copper and Gold in Mocoa, the capital of the Putumayo department in Colombia.
The adventurous will seek out El Macho’s salsa y salsa ropa vieja or a sweet chili-laden wood-grilled Atlantic salmon. Universal Orlando ResortĪn early favorite is the lineup of “despica-bowls,” including Asian-inspired Otto’s Noodle Bowl (complete with a tableside presentation) and plant-based offering Carl’s Crispy Cauliflower. The 20-plus menu items were inspired by memorable characters and are an eclectic mix of globally inspired foods and accessible favorites with flair. It’s far from the mundane park fare (sorry! No hot dogs here!) and lucky for us, the theming extends directly to our forks. The immersive restaurant transports you directly into the film’s eye-catching details with themed dining rooms and plenty of colorful art pieces-courtesy of the Minions, of course! Even the team members are in on the fun as they socialize with guests, speaking the official Minion language.Įnough of the nitty-gritty details because you’re probably thinking: Bello! Get to the goods! The food at Minion Café is where the Universal team truly flexes its culinary muscles. Finally, erase any stray lines or unnecessary marks that you may have made during this process.Ĭongratulations! You have now finished drawing your own version of Bob from Despicable Me! Drawing can be both fun and rewarding if you take your time and pay attention to detail throughout each step in the process.A post shared by Universal Orlando Resort is always on the menu at Illumination’s Minion Café. For the legs, draw four straight lines coming out from the bottom of Bob’s body (two on each side). To complete Bob’s body we will need to add some arms and legs! Starting with the arms, draw two small ovals near Bob’s head (one on each side) connected by two short straight lines. Incarnations On BTVA: 10 Versions from 10 Titles. USERNAME: PASSWORD: Forgot password Remember Me Dont have an account Join BTVA. Then add two small circles at the bottom of this oval and connect them with another curved line just like we did in step 2. Images of the Bob the Minion voice actors from the Despicable Me franchise. Now that you have drawn all of Bob’s features it is time to move on his body! Start by drawing an oval shape beneath Bob’s head that is slightly smaller than the one used for his head. Finally, finish up by drawing a few more curved lines around Bob’s eyes and mouth to give him some facial features. Then, draw an upside-down U shape between his eyes for a nose. Now comes the fun part – adding all of Bob’s accessories! First, draw two curved lines underneath his eyes for eyebrows and a few short straight lines above them for eyelashes. Also, draw two more curved lines on either side of his head for his hair. Now, connect the ear circles with a curved line to complete the top of his head. Next, draw two small circles for his ears and two small lines for his smile. And don’t forget to add two eyes near the top of the oval. Make sure that it isn’t too round or too pointed at any point. Start by drawing a large oval shape for the head. So grab your pencils and get ready to create some adorable art! Step 1: Have you ever wanted to draw a cute and cuddly minion like Bob from Despicable Me? If so, then this tutorial is for you! In this step-by-step guide, we will show you how to draw a perfect rendition of the beloved character. King Bob was a gift to players when 28,351,768,925 bananas were collected by the Despicable Me: Minion Rush community back in June 2021. 29+ Minion Names from Despicable Me Bob, Carl, Darwin, Dave, Frank NovemTag Vault What are the names of each Minions Did you know that there are over one hundred minions in the Despicable Me movies And each one of them has a name Minions are small, yellow, cylindrical creatures who have one or two eyes. Schematic representation of a nuclear chain reaction – energy release not shown.Īlong with a means of instigating nuclear fission in the reactor core, it is important to be able to control the rate at which the uranium atoms are undergoing fission. It is this chain reaction that provides the basis for nuclear research reactors and nuclear power, as it releases not only neutrons and fission products, but also large quantities of energy. This suggests the possibility that the neutrons released when one uranium-235 nucleus undergoes fission can induce the fission of up to three neighbouring uranium-235 nuclei, each of which will also release neutrons as it fissions, which can interact with other uranium-235 atoms, and so on, thus creating a self-sustaining nuclear chain reaction. Looking more closely at the figure above, it becomes evident that the nuclear fission of uranium-235 produces more neutrons (three in this example) than it consumes (one). Schematic representation of an induced nuclear fission event: uranium-235 captures a neutron and fragments into two smaller atomic nuclei, releasing neutrons and energy. Neutron bombardment can also be used to increase the rate of nuclear fission in nuclei that undergo this process spontaneously, such as uranium-235 (see Figure). Nuclei that are susceptible to this “induced nuclear fission” include plutonium-239 and uranium-233. For example, a slow-moving or “thermal” neutron can be absorbed into the nucleus of an atom, rendering it unstable and causing it to fission instantly. In addition to nuclei that fission spontaneously, many other atomic nuclei can be induced to undergo nuclear fission by bombarding them with sub-atomic particles. The periodic table of the elements (from Heavy elements such as the actinoids are prone to nuclear fission. Despite being a spontaneous process, fission of these nuclei occurs very slowly in nature: the fission half-life of uranium-235 is 1.2 x 1017 years, which corresponds to one fission per gram per hour. Examples of materials in nature that spontaneously undergo nuclear fission are uranium-235 (an atomic nucleus containing 92 protons and 143 neutrons) and thorium-232 (90 protons and 142 neutrons). Nuclear fission only occurs in the heaviest elements of the periodic table: principally, the actinoid series, but more generally, those with atomic weights greater than 232 atomic mass units. This is often accompanied by the emission of neutrons, charged fragments such as alpha particles, and energy in the form of gamma or X-rays. Nuclear fission is a naturally occurring phenomenon during which an atomic nucleus is divided into two or more parts.
The stash command can be very powerful, and there are more features to it than what was covered here, like various flags that are available, which we'll save for another article. Here we've seen how to handle the use-case where you have changes in your working directory, but you want to switch branches and not commit the unfinished changes. Unsurprisingly, Git has a solution for most problems that arise in version control since it's been around for such a long time. $ git stash list : WIP on master: bbf6ef9 Initial commit You're able to view this stack using the list subcommand. Technically, when you stash changes, Git puts the changes on a stack, which can then be pulled off in a LIFO (last in, first out) order. When you’re ready to reapply your changes, you will have the option to apply or pop your stash to your currently checked out branch. Creating a stash in Git saves uncommitted changes so you can work on other things in your repository without losing your work. What if, for example, you end up needing to stash changes from your working directory multiple times? Luckily, stash allows you to do just that. Here is where the Git stash command comes in. If you wish to see the contents of your most recent stash, you can run: git stash show. This will put your working copy in a clean state and allow you to run different commands, such as Git checkout or Git pull. As we tend to find out in our day-to-day programming, real-world use-cases aren't usually that simple. To stash uncommitted local changes in Git using the terminal, you will simply run the Git stash command. In the examples above, we used stash in the simplest context. $ git stash applyĪnd just like that, you have your changes back. We're back to where we started as if we never made the changes at all! Now you can go off and fix that bug.īut what about restoring your changes? To get them back, we can simply use the apply sub-command, which takes the last-stashed changes and puts them back into your working directory. To verify, look for changes using git status: $ git status Saved working directory and index state WIP on master: bbf6ef9 Initial commitĪs you can see, HEAD is now back to our last commit, which in this case is the initial commit. To avoid losing the current updates you've made, you can just stash the changes instead and get them back later without messing up your commit history. However, the changes aren't finished, and you need to switch to a different branch to quickly fix a bug before continuing on with the current feature. No changes added to commit (use "git add" and/or "git commit -a") " to discard changes in working directory) Let's say you're working on a new feature and you made some modifications to your code, and you now have one or more files with uncommitted modifications: $ git status The stash command takes the uncommitted changes in your working directory, both the updated tracked files and staged changes, and saves them. Luckily, Git provides a mechanism to handle cases like this through the command git stash. However, you don't want to lose the changes you've made already, but they're not yet ready to commit the updates since they're not finished. If you've been working with Git long enough, you've probably had times where you made changes to your codebase, but needed to switch branches or work with the latest working version of your code. |